Q: Is 184,415,376 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 184,415,376 is a composite number.

Why is 184,415,376 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 184,415,376 can be evenly divided by 1 2 3 4 6 8 12 16 24 41 48 82 83 123 164 166 246 249 328 332 492 498 656 664 984 996 1,129 1,328 1,968 1,992 2,258 3,387 3,403 3,984 4,516 6,774 6,806 9,032 10,209 13,548 13,612 18,064 20,418 27,096 27,224 40,836 46,289 54,192 54,448 81,672 92,578 93,707 138,867 163,344 185,156 187,414 277,734 281,121 370,312 374,828 555,468 562,242 740,624 749,656 1,110,936 1,124,484 1,499,312 2,221,872 2,248,968 3,841,987 4,497,936 7,683,974 11,525,961 15,367,948 23,051,922 30,735,896 46,103,844 61,471,792 92,207,688 and 184,415,376, with no remainder.

Since 184,415,376 cannot be divided by just 1 and 184,415,376, it is a composite number.
